RESOLUTION NO. R23-17
A RESOLUTION O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
GLENDALE,
MARICOPA
COUNTY,
ARIZONA,
ADJUSTING LANDFILL RATE FEES PURSUANT TO
GLENDALE
CITY
CODE;
AND
SETTING
FORTH
EFFECTIVE DATES.
WHEREAS, rate adjustments are necessary to provide the City with adequate
financial resources to maintain uninterrupted landfill operations and management
services and to provide high quality customer service to Glendale residents and remain
in compliance with federal, state, and local regulations; and
WHEREAS, the Field Operations Department is continuously reviewing rates
and fees to ensure timely replacement of equipment and adequate staffing; and
WHEREAS, the last rate increase for landfill gate rate collection fees for waste
disposed at the landfill occurred on February 8, 2022; and
WHEREAS, pursuant to the Glendale City Code, Chapter 18, Article IV,
Section 18-141, a schedule of landfill collection services and fees shall be
established by resolution by the City Council.
B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F GLENDALE as
follows:
SECTION 1. Landfill services and fees that apply to the materials deposited on
site shall be adjusted as follows:

• The Environmental Fee of $2.00 per ton will be added to the minimum
transaction fee and the gate rate. The fee will be applied as an increase to each
rate and will not be pro-rated for minimum transaction fees.
SECTION 2. That the adjusted rates and fees set forth in Section 1 shall be
effective April 1, 2023 for 2023 rates, and January 1st of each following year.
PASSED, ADOPTED AND APPROVED by the Mayor and Council of the
City of Glendale, Maricopa County, Arizona, this day of 14th day of March, 2023.
